ON-LINE DATA REDUCTION BY ANALOG COMPUTERS

Technical Report ·
OSTI ID:4740973
The use of analog computers in reduction of data at test sites and experimental facilities for the immediate use of engineers is discussed. An example of use in the Transient Reactivity Meter is described. The meter computes the reactivity of the reactor in an operating power plant. The theory of operation and uses are discussed.
